Question

The rainwater and ________________ from other sources such as rivers and ponds seeps through the ______________ and fills the empty spaces and cracks deep below the ground. The process of seeping of water into the ground is called ______________.

Solution

Infiltration:

  1. Rainwater is absorbed into the ground by the process of infiltration.
  2. During infiltration, the water on ground surfaces enters the soil.
  3. The infiltration rate depends on the earth and rock below the ground surface.
  4. Rocks retain less water than soil. Thus, infiltration is more.
  5. The water that gets infiltrated is known as groundwater.
  6. Groundwater can go to rivers or streams or sink deep and form aquifers.

Thus, the rainwater and water from other sources such as rivers and ponds seep through the soil and fills the empty spaces and cracks deep below the ground. The process of seeping water into the ground is called infiltration.
